Poodles are known for their grace and style. These dogs have a regal air about them, so it’s fitting to give them names that match their elegant nature. Choosing the right name for your poodle can be a fun and rewarding experience.

When picking a name for your poodle, think about names that sound classy and sophisticated. Many poodle owners choose names inspired by fashion, royalty, or luxury brands. You might want to consider names that reflect your poodle’s appearance or personality. A good name will suit your dog and be easy for you to say.

1. Bella

Bella means “beautiful” in Italian, which fits perfectly with the elegant and graceful nature of poodles. When you name your poodle Bella, you’re giving her a name that reflects her charming personality. Poodles are known for their intelligence and beauty, making Bella an ideal choice.

2. Maximilian

Maximilian is a grand name for your poodle. It comes from Latin and means “greatest.” This name suits a poodle well, as they are often seen as regal and sophisticated dogs.

3. Sophia

Sophia means “wisdom” in Greek, which fits well with the poodle’s smart nature. This name has a timeless quality that suits poodles of all ages. The name sounds elegant and classy, matching the poodle’s graceful look.

4. Oliver

Oliver means “olive tree” and has roots in Old French and Medieval English. The name brings to mind sophistication and charm. You might choose Oliver for your poodle if you want a name that sounds distinguished.

5. Amelia

Amelia is a charming name for your poodle. It has a regal and sophisticated sound that matches the poodle’s elegant appearance. The name Amelia means “work” in German. This fits well with poodles, as they are intelligent and hardworking dogs.

6. Theodore

Theodore comes from Greek roots meaning “gift of God.” This name gives your poodle a sense of importance and dignity. You might choose Theodore for a male poodle with a regal air. The name suits poodles of all sizes, from toy to standard. It’s especially fitting for a poodle with a calm, wise demeanor.

7. Aurora

Aurora is a dazzling name choice for your poodle. It means “dawn” in Latin and refers to the goddess of the morning in Roman mythology. This name suits poodles with light-colored coats, especially those with golden or reddish hues. The name Aurora evokes images of the sun rising and casting a warm glow across the sky.

8. Sebastian

Sebastian is a name that exudes sophistication and charm. It’s perfect for a poodle with a regal bearing and elegant demeanor.

9. Luna

Luna means “moon” in Latin and carries an air of elegance and mystery. This name fits well with a poodle’s graceful appearance and intelligent nature.

10. Hudson

Hudson has a classy and refined sound that matches the breed’s elegant appearance. The name Hudson comes from an English surname. It means “son of Hugh” or “Hugh’s son.” Hugh was a popular name in medieval times.

11. Chanel

Chanel is a stylish and sophisticated name for your female poodle. It pays tribute to the iconic fashion designer Coco Chanel, known for her elegant and timeless creations.

12. Gatsby

Gatsby is a name that brings elegance and charm to your poodle. It’s inspired by the famous literary character from F. Scott Fitzgerald’s novel “The Great Gatsby.”

13. Monet

Monet is a classy name for your poodle. It brings to mind the famous French Impressionist painter Claude Monet. This name suits poodles well, given their French heritage.

14. Savannah

Savannah brings to mind the warm, sunny city in Georgia known for its Southern hospitality. This name suits a sweet-natured poodle. If your dog has a gentle, friendly personality, Savannah could be a perfect fit.

15. Coco

Coco is a charming name for a Poodle. It brings to mind elegance and sophistication, perfect for this stylish breed.

16. Juliet

Juliet brings to mind the romantic heroine from Shakespeare’s famous play. This name suits a poodle with grace and elegance. Your Juliet poodle might have a loving and affectionate nature. The name reflects both beauty and passion, perfect for a dog breed known for its intelligence and charm.

17. Henry

Henry is a classic name that suits a poodle perfectly. It has a regal and distinguished feel, making it ideal for this elegant breed. The name Henry comes from Germanic roots meaning “home ruler.” This fits well with a poodle’s confident and sometimes bossy nature.

18. Thalia

Thalia comes from Greek mythology and means “to bloom” or “flourishing.” Your poodle will stand out with this sophisticated name. Thalia was one of the nine Muses in Greek mythology, associated with comedy and idyllic poetry.

19. Tristan

Tristan is a name that gives your poodle a touch of romance and legend. It comes from Celtic origins and means “noise” or “outcry.”

20. Esme

Esme comes from French origins and means “esteemed” or “loved.” This elegant name suits the refined nature of poodles perfectly. Your dog will stand out with this sophisticated moniker.

21. Percival

Percival comes from Old French and means “one who pierces the valley.” This name gives your dog a regal and sophisticated air. You might choose Percival if you want your poodle to have a name with a touch of medieval romance. It brings to mind knights of the Round Table and chivalrous deeds.

22. Penelope

Penelope has Greek origins and means “weaver” or “duck.” This name brings to mind elegance and sophistication. It’s perfect for a poodle with a regal bearing or graceful movements.

23. Zara

Zara is a stylish and elegant name for your poodle. This name has Spanish origins and means “blooming flower” or “radiant.” Zara gives your poodle a touch of sophistication. It’s short, easy to say, and has a nice ring to it when you call your dog.

24. Noble

Noble is a perfect name for a poodle with a regal bearing. This name captures the breed’s elegance and dignified nature. Poodles often carry themselves with grace and poise. The name Noble reflects these traits, making it a great choice for your furry friend.

25. Yara

Yara is a beautiful and unique name for your poodle. It has roots in several cultures, giving it a worldly and sophisticated feel. In Arabic, Yara means “small butterfly,” which perfectly captures the graceful and delicate nature of poodles. This name could be ideal for a petite toy or miniature poodle.
